Summary: The General Superintendent provides comprehensive on-site management of multiple construction project sites, ensuring all projects are executed in accordance with the overall design, budget, and schedule. This role involves high-level oversight and coordination across various construction activities and project stakeholders.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ities:

· Oversee the total construction efforts across multiple project sites to ensure adherence to design, budget, and schedule, including interfacing with client representatives, AE representatives, and other contractors.

· Plan, coordinate, and supervise onsite functions across projects, including scheduling, engineering, material control, and the direction of onsite administrative staff in accounting, purchasing, etc.

· Supervise craft employees and other contractors as required by contracts across multiple sites.

· Authorize and approve all project personnel transactions, purchase requisitions, field design change requests, etc., as needed.

· Provide high-level technical assistance, such as interpretation of drawings, recommendation of construction methods, and selection of equipment, as required.

· Assist project management in developing and implementing project procedures, working documents, standards, and safety programs across all sites.

· Ensure compliance with all project procedures, safety program requirements, and work rules across all projects. Document violations, notify project management, and implement corrective actions as required.

· Assume responsibility for the productivity of crafts, efficient use of materials and equipment, and contractual performance of the project.

· Perform additional duties as directed by senior management.

Supervisory Responsibilities:

· Directly manage multiple subordinate supervisors, each responsible for various field operations across project sites.

· Indirectly oversee a broader range of team members engaged in field operations.

Requirements:

· Extensive knowledge and experience in site work Electrical construction activities, including medium and low voltage cable installation. All PV wiring, SCADA, Inverter, Combiner box and or Low Break Disconnect Box’s. MV and DC Terminations.

· Extensive knowledge in LOTTO implementation and commissioning requirements.

· Willingness and ability to travel frequently between project sites, potentially out of town or state.

· Strong leadership, communication, and organizational skills, capable of managing multiple projects and teams.

Education and Experience:

· Four-year engineering degree or equivalent combination of technical training and related experience.

· Minimum of ten years of construction management and/or craft supervision experience across diverse construction projects.

· Thorough knowledge of all aspects of construction including technology, equipment, methods; craft agreements, jurisdiction, negotiations, engineering, cost control schedules, and safety.
